What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
You can place most kinds of debris into a cost to rent dumpster in Locustville.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something introduces an environmental hazard, you likely cannot set it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are uncertain.
That makes most types of debris that you could set in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Specific forms of acceptable deb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to ask the rental business whether you need to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?
Picking a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for people to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, practically, they have no idea how much material their roofs include.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a good al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you'll probably require a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.
In case you are working on residential roofing job,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ably desire a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of folks order one size bigger than they think their projects will take because they want to avoid the extra exp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that were not large enough.

What if I need my dumpster in Locustville picked up early?
When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Locustville, part of your rental agreement contains a given duration of time you're allowed to use the container. You usually base this time on the length of time you think your project might take. The bigger the project, the the more time you will need the dumpster. Most cost to rent dumpster companies in Locustville give you a speed for a specific number of days. Should you surpass that quantity of days, you will pay an additional fee per day. In case the project goes more rapidly than expected, you might be finished with the dumpster sooner than you anticipated.
If that is true, give the dumpster company a call and they will probably come pick your container up early; this will permit them to rent it to someone else more immediately. You typically will not get a discount on your own rate if you ask for early pickup.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or whatever your term is), whether you use them all or not.
10 yard dumpster measurements in Locustville
A 10 yard dumpster is constructed to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will vary with different companies.
It can be hard to select exactly the container size you will need for your home project,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up jobs.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is large en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you don't want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
